Kogi AG, Habibat Oyiza Onumoko, greets muslims at Ramadan, says Gov. Ododo is Committed to the welfare of all Kogites

Kogi State Accountant-General, Hajia Habibat Oyiza Onumoko Ph.D, FCNA has congratulated muslims in the state on the commencement of the Islamic Holy Month of Ramadan.

She enjoined the muslim faithful in the state to remain steadfast to the lessons of the holy month of Ramadan which include patience, forgiveness, charity, good neighborliness, and righteousness.

The AG urged the adherents of the Islamic faith to use the period of Ramadan for spiritual cleansing, and to also pray for sustained unity and peace in the state. 

Speaking on the achievements recorded by the present administration in the last 30 days, the Accountant-General said the government of His Excellency, Alh. Ahmed Usman Ododo is people-centred, and committed to the welfare of all Kogites, noting further that the government is doing all within its means to lesson the hardship faced by the people.

The AG posited that the task of building the future of Kogi State requires a collective effort, calling on the people of the state irrespective of religion, political affiliation or tribe, to come together to pray to God for the continued peace, progress, and the wellbeing of the people of the state and the country.
